Key Features & Highlights
- Open Floor Plans: Removing walls to create open, flowing spaces enhances natural light and fosters better social interaction among family members.
- Sustainable Materials: Using eco-friendly options like reclaimed wood, bamboo flooring, or recycled glass countertops reduces environmental impact while adding unique character to your home.
- Smart Home Technology: Integrating systems like smart thermostats, lighting, and security cameras improves convenience, energy efficiency, and safety.
- Maximizing Natural Light: Large windows, skylights, or glass doors can brighten up spaces and make them feel more spacious and welcoming.
- Multi-Functional Furniture: Pieces like sofa beds, storage ottomans, or foldable desks help maximize space in smaller homes or apartments.
- Bold Color Accents: Painting an accent wall or adding colorful decor can infuse energy and personality into any room without overwhelming the space.
- Outdoor Living Extensions: Creating a cozy patio, deck, or garden area extends your living space outdoors, perfect for relaxation or entertaining guests.
Frequently Asked Questions / Pros & Cons
What are the most cost-effective home renovation projects?
Some of the most budget-friendly updates include repainting walls, updating cabinet hardware, replacing light fixtures, and refreshing grout in bathrooms. These small changes can make a significant difference without requiring a large investment.
How do I choose the right contractor for my renovation?
Start by asking for recommendations from friends or family, and check online reviews for local contractors. Always request multiple quotes, verify licenses and insurance, and ask to see examples of their previous work. A good contractor will communicate clearly and provide a detailed contract outlining the scope of work and payment schedule.
What are the pros and cons of DIY versus hiring professionals?
DIY Pros: Cost savings, creative control, and a sense of accomplishment from completing projects yourself.
DIY Cons: Time-consuming, potential for mistakes, and limited access to tools or expertise for complex tasks.
Hiring Professionals Pros: Expertise, efficiency, and often higher-quality results, especially for structural or electrical work.
Hiring Professionals Cons: Higher costs and less personal involvement in the process.
How can I renovate on a tight budget?
Focus on high-impact, low-cost changes like decluttering, rearranging furniture, or adding decorative elements like mirrors and plants. Shop for secondhand furniture or materials at salvage yards, and consider doing some of the work yourself. Prioritize projects that offer the best return on investment, such as updating kitchens or bathrooms.
What should I consider before starting a major renovation?
First, assess the structural integrity of your home and address any critical issues like plumbing or electrical problems. Then, establish a realistic budget and timeline, keeping in mind potential delays. Think about how the renovation will impact your daily life and whether you need to arrange temporary living arrangements. Finally, consider the long-term value of the changes to ensure they align with your future plans.
Practical Guidance & Solutions
Embarking on a home renovation journey requires thoughtful preparation and execution. Start by defining your goals. Do you want a more functional kitchen, a relaxing bathroom retreat, or a spacious living area for entertaining? Once you have a clear vision, create a detailed plan that includes a budget, timeline, and list of required materials. Prioritize projects based on urgency and impact, tackling one room or area at a time to avoid feeling overwhelmed.
Before hiring contractors or purchasing supplies, gather inspiration from magazines, online platforms, or home improvement shows. This will help you communicate your ideas clearly to professionals and ensure you stay within your desired style. If you’re on a tight budget, consider phased renovations, where you complete essential projects first and save less critical updates for later.
During the renovation process, maintain open communication with your contractor and address any issues promptly to avoid costly mistakes. Keep your living space organized by designating a storage area for tools and materials.
